Microwave Dielectric Properties of Ultra-Low Temperature Co-firable Ba3V4O13-BaV2O6 Ceramics (Ba3V4O13-BaV2O6계 초저온 동시소성 세라믹스의 마이크로파 유전 특성)

  • Phase evolution, sintering behavior, microstructure, and microwave dielectric properties of (1-x) mol Ba3V4O13 - (x) mol BaV2O6 system were investigated. The sintered specimens of all compositions consisted of Ba3V4O13 and BaV2O6, and no secondary phase was observed. As x increased, the linear shrinkage decreased to the composition of x=0.5, and then increased again, implying that Ba3V4O13 and BaV2O6 phases interfered mutually with each other during sintering. All compositions showed a dense microstructure with a large grain growth. Cracks were observed in some compositions because of the relatively high sintering temperature of 620~640℃. As x increased, the dielectric constant increased, while the quality factor was maintained from about 50,000 GHz to about 70,000 GHz up to the composition of x=0.9, and then decreased to 20,987~27,180 GHz at the composition of x=1.0. As x increased, the temperature coefficient of the resonance frequency showed a (+) value from a (-) value. The dielectric constant, the quality factor, and the temperature coefficient of resonant frequency of x=0.7 composition sintered at 640℃ for 4 hours were 10.61, 71,126 GHz, and -4.9 ppm/℃, respectively. This composition showed a good chemical compatibility with Al powder, indicating that the Ba3V4O13-BaV2O6 ceramics are a candidate material for ULTCC (Ultra-Low Temperature Co-fired Ceramics) applications.

Microwave Dielectric Properties of (Mg1-xNix)(Ti0.95(Mg1/3Ta2/3)0.05)O3 Ceramics ((Mg1-xNix)(Ti0.95(Mg1/3Ta2/3)0.05)O3 세라믹스의 마이크로파 유전 특성)

  • The effects of Ni2+ substitution for Mg2+-sites on the microwave dielectric properties of (Mg1-xNix)(Ti0.95(Mg1/3Ta2/3)0.05)O3 (0.01 ≤ x ≤ 0.05) (MNTMT) ceramics were investigated. MNTMT ceramics were prepared by conventional solid-state reaction. When the MgO / TiO2 ratio was changed from 1.00 to 1.02, MgTi2O5 was detected as a secondary phase along with the MgTiO3 main phase in the MNTMT specimens sintered at 1,400 ℃ for 4h. For the MNTMT specimens with MgO / TiO2 = 1.07 sintered at 1,400 ℃ for 4h, a single phase of MgTiO3 with an ilmenite structure was obtained from the entire range of compositions. The relative density of all the specimens sintered at 1,400 ℃ for 4h was higher than 95 %. The quality factor (Qf) of the sintered specimens depended strongly on the degree of covalency of the specimens, and the sintered specimens with x = 0.01 showed the maximum Qf value of 489,400 GHz. The dielectric constant (K) decreased with increasing Ni2+ content because Ni2+ had a lower dielectric polarizability (1.23Å3) than Mg2+ (1.32Å3). As Ni2+ content increased, the temperature coefficient of resonant frequency (TCF) improved, from -55.56 to -21.85 ppm/℃, due to the increase in tolerance factor (t) and the lower dielectric constant (K).

Crack growth analysis and remaining life prediction of dissimilar metal pipe weld joint with circumferential crack under cyclic loading

  • Fatigue crack growth model has been developed for dissimilar metal weld joints of a piping component under cyclic loading, where in the crack is located at the center of the weld in the circumferential direction. The fracture parameter, Stress Intensity Factor (SIF) has been computed by using principle of superposition as KH + KM. KH is evaluated by assuming that, the complete specimen is made of the material containing the notch location. In second stage, the stress field ahead of the crack tip, accounting for the strength mismatch, the applied load and geometry has been characterized to evaluate SIF (KM). For each incremental crack depth, stress field ahead of the crack tip has been quantified by using J-integral (elastic), mismatch ratio, plastic interaction factor and stress parallel to the crack surface. The associated constants for evaluation of KM have been computed by using the quantified stress field with respect to the distance from the crack tip. Net SIF (KH + KM) computed, has been used for the crack growth analysis and remaining life prediction by Paris crack growth model. To validate the model, SIF and remaining life has been predicted for a pipe made up of (i) SA312 Type 304LN austenitic stainless steel and SA508 Gr. 3 Cl. 1. Low alloy carbon steel (ii) welded SA312 Type 304LN austenitic stainless-steel pipe. From the studies, it is observed that the model could predict the remaining life of DMWJ piping components with a maximum difference of 15% compared to experimental observations.

Dust scattering simulation of far-ultraviolet light in the Milky Way

  • We performed three-dimensional Monte Carlo dust scattering radiative transfer simulations for FUV light to obtain dust scattered FUV images and compared them with the observed FUV image obtained by FIMS/SPEAR and GALEX. From this, we find the scattering properties of interstellar dust in our Galaxy and suggest the intensity of extragalactic background light (EBL) at FUV wavelength. The best-fit values of the scattering properties of interstellar dust are albedo = 0.38-0.04+0.04, g-factor = 0.55-0.15+0.10, and EBL = 138-23+21 CU for the allsky which are consistent well with the Milky Way dust model of Draine and direct measurements of Gardner et al., respectively. At the high Galactic latitude of |b|>10°, the observation is well fitted with the model of lower albedo = 0.35-0.04+0.06 and g-factor = 0.50-0.20+0.15. On the contrary, the scattering properties of interstellar dust show higher albedo = 0.43-0.02+0.02 and g-factor = 0.65-0.15+0.05 near the Galactic plane of |b|<10°. In the present simulation, recent three-dimensional distribution maps of interstellar dust in our Galaxy, stellar distances in the catalog of GAIA DR2, and FUV fluxes and/or spectral types in the TD-1 and Hipparcos star catalogs were used.

Structural suitability of GdFeO3 as a magnetic buffer layer for GdBa2Cu3O7-x superconducting thin films

  • We investigated the structural suitability of GdFeO3 (GdFO) as a buffer layer for the GdBa2xCu3O7-x (GdBCO) superconducting films. GdFO films with different thicknesses and GdBCO thin films were all prepared by using a pulsed laser deposition technique. The analyses of X-ray diffraction and EXAFS data indicates that the c-axis parameter increases and the Fe-O bond length decreases with the GdFO thickness due to the compressive stain induced by the lattice mismatch between GdFO and STO substrate and as a result, the Debye-Waller factor, an index of disorder in the local structure near the Fe-O bond, increases with the GdFO thickness. However, for the GdBCO/GdFO bilayer structure, the Debye-Waller factor decreases as the GdFO thickness increases indicating a diminished disorder by the structural coupling between GdFO and GdBCO. These results indicate that an appropriate thickness of GdFO is required to be utilized as a magnetic buffer layer for the GdBCO superconducting films.
